Member Information
Members; appointment, term, quorum, officers; role of city manager's office.
Youth opportunity board consisting of eleven (11) members.
- Each member of the city council shall nominate two (2) members of the youth opportunity board, with one nomination to be at-large and appointed by a majority vote of the council. Four (4) of the members shall be in middle school or high school. Two (2) of these four (4) members shall be the President or Vice President of the student government at a North Miami high school. Each nominee shall be subject to the approval of a majority of the city council. Each member shall hold office until the second Tuesday in June of the odd-numbered year next following appointment, members to serve at the pleasure of the council. All terms shall begin and end at noon on the date indicated. The council member who originally nominated a board member vacating office by resignation or otherwise shall nominate a successor to serve out the unexpired term. The successor nominee shall be subject to approval by a majority of the city council.
- Six (6) members of the board shall constitute a quorum for the transaction of business. During the first September meeting of each year, the board shall elect one (I) of their members to act as chair, one (I) as co-chair and one (I) as corresponding secretary.
About the Board
The Youth Opportunity Board, established by the following ordinances reviews, studies and sponsors educational, recreational and cultural activities for youth in North Miami:
- Ordinance 1354 on March 26, 2013
- Ordinance 1133 on March 25, 2003
- Ordinance 1126 on March 25, 2003
- Ordinance 1021 on August 24, 1999
- Ordinance 720.5 on May 26, 1981
- Ordinance 720.4 on April 13, 1976
- Ordinance 720.2 on October 12, 1971
- Ordinance 720.1 on September 14, 1971
- Ordinance 720 on September 22, 1970
